Barber, hair & beauty worth £6.6 billion to UK The barber, hair and beauty industry contributes £6.6 billion to the UK economy, which equates to at least 8% of total of retail sales, says a new report unveiled at the Palace of Westminster to an audience of politicians and industry professionals.

The Hair and Barber Council and BABTAC (British Association of Beauty Therapy & Cosmetology) revealed the findings as part of their bid to persuade the Government to amend the current voluntary Hairdressing Act to that of Mandatory, whilst adding Beauty into the body of the Act. The report also showed that the UK has more than 49,000 hair and beauty businesse which employs 337,000 people, including 16,500 apprentices.
